I'm trying to disable a bunch of programs that were
automatically put in to my navigation area on Windows XP
when I installed them. I tried the msconfig-startup and
cleared the ones I don't want. When I restart it brings
up my msconfig screen again. It wants me to put it back
in normal mode instead of selective. Does anybody know
how to get them out of my navigation area? THANKS
 
D

Doug Knox MS-MVP

When it asks you if you want to go to Normal startup, click Don't show me
this again, and don't choose Normal startup.

Alternatively, you can go to www.dougknox.com, Win XP Fixes, Disable
MSConfig Selective Startup Screen. After making your changes in MSCONFIG,
run this script, and it will remove the Registry entry that causes MSConfig
to run the next time you logon.

Hi Lori,

Check for an option to not having the icon load in the System Tray via the
program(s) in question.

Other options for removal:

Go to Start/Run and type in: msconfig. Go to the Startup Tab and uncheck
accordingly. Then run this script to remove the disabled items from the
registry.

Clear Disabled Items from Msconfig Startup (Line 148)
http://www.kellys-korner-xp.com/xp_tweaks.htm

Or...remove the runkeys from here: Start/Run/Regedit

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
